0

ハドソンをセットアップしたばかりで、いじり始めました。

  1. email-ext.hpi を $HUDSON_HOME\plugins フォルダーにダウンロードしました。
  2. hudson post-step1 を再起動しました (「ハドソンの管理」ページからプラグインを自動的にインストールする方法を (プロキシ設定の理由で) 使用できないため、この手動の方法に従います。
  3. hudson の起動時にエラーは表示されません。実際、INFO: Started all plugins という行が表示されます

BUT:
プロジェクト構成ページを開始すると、約束されたオプション「編集可能な電子メール通知」が表示されません。

参考までに:
1. いくつかの基本的なテスト ビルドをセットアップして実行することができ、正常に動作します。
2. また、失敗とその後の成功のために、デフォルトのハドソン電子メールを構成して受信することもできます (これにより、SMTP 設定が確認されます)。同じように!

私は何が欠けていますか?助けてくれてありがとう!

追加情報: Hudson バージョン - Windows XP で動作する 1.379

4

3 に答える 3

0

OK-回避策を見つけました(ただし、これが問題である理由をまだ掘り下げる必要があります)。この問題に直面する可能性のある他の人のためにここに記録します。

$HUDSON_HOME\plugin にコピーされたときのプラグインは、どういうわけか実際にはアクティブ化/認識されていませんでした。しかし、それを C:\Documents and Settings\mylogin.hudson\plugins にもコピーして、hudson サービスを再起動すると、できあがり! 出来た。

これが発生した理由を誰かが知っている場合は、参照用にここに記録してください。ありがとう。

于 2010-10-06T10:48:55.767 に答える
0

プラグインをインストールするには、簡単なルートを使用する必要があります。Hudson で、[Manage Hudson] -> [Manager Plugins] -> [Advanced] (タブ) に移動し、[upload plugin] オプションを使用します。

指示に従ってください。通常、実際にプラグインを取得するには Hudson を再起動する必要があります。

ファイルシステムをいじるよりもはるかに節約できます。一般的に、あなたのアプローチは正しいはずですが、$HUDSON_HOME に問題があるようです。"Manage Hudson" -> "Configure System" ページを見てください。ページの上部に表示される Hudson ホーム ディレクトリとは何ですか? ホーム ディレクトリにアクセスできない場合、Hudson が何をするかわかりません。ここでは、Hudson がローカル システム アカウントではなくユーザー アカウントを使用してサービスとして実行され、別のアカウントを使用して hpi ファイルをコピーしたと仮定しています。

于 2010-10-06T17:42:16.407 に答える